Skip to content

Commit 3d0ba2d

Browse files
authored
Merge pull request #293 from robjtede/doc-auto-cfg
Document crate feature guarded items on docs.rs
2 parents c5f7c9a + 2cae482 commit 3d0ba2d

File tree

3 files changed

+3
-1
lines changed

3 files changed

+3
-1
lines changed

Cargo.toml

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-56,4 +56,5 @@ required-features = ["completion"]
5656
no_individual_tags = true
5757

5858
[package.metadata.docs.rs]
59+
rustdoc-args = ["--cfg", "docsrs"]
5960
all-features = true

src/error.rs

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-10,5 +10,5 @@ pub enum Error {
1010
IO(#[from] IoError),
1111
}
1212

13-
/// Result type where errors are of type [Error](crate::error::Error)
13+
/// Result type where errors are of type [Error](enum@Error).
1414
pub type Result<T = ()> = StdResult<T, Error>;

src/lib.rs

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-30,6 +30,7 @@
3030
//! By default `editor` and `password` are enabled.
3131
3232
#![deny(clippy::all)]
33+
#![cfg_attr(docsrs, feature(doc_auto_cfg))]
3334

3435
pub use console;
3536

0 commit comments

Comments
 (0)